Traditional Home-Baked White Bread

Delight in the comforting aroma and taste of homemade white bread with its soft, fluffy texture and golden-brown crust. Perfect for sandwiches or a warm snack.
Prep time: 15 minutes
Cook time: 30 minutes
Serves: 16

Ingredients

5 cups all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ons sugar
1 tablespoon salt
1 packet (2 1/4 teaspoons) active dry yeast
2 cups warm water (110°F)
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
Additional flour for kneading
Butter for greasing

Instructions

1. In a large bowl, combine warm water, sugar, and yeast. Let sit for 5-10 minutes until foamy.
2. Add flour, salt, and melted butter to the yeast mixture. Mix until a dough begins to form.
3. Turn the dough onto a floured surface and knead for about 8-10 minutes until smooth and elastic.
4. Place the dough in a greased bowl, cover with a damp cloth, and let rise in a warm place for about 1 hour or until doubled in size.
5. Punch down the dough, divide it into two equal parts, and shape each into a loaf.
6. Place the loaves in greased 9x5 inch loaf pans, cover, and let rise again for 30-40 minutes until doubled.
7.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
8. Bake the loaves for 25-30 minutes or until the tops are golden brown and the bread sounds hollow when tapped.
9. Remove from the oven and let cool slightly before removing from the pans. Cool completely on a wire rack.

Storage

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or freeze for up to 3 months.

Reheating

To reheat, wrap in foil and place in a preheated 350°F (175°C) oven for 10 minutes, or toast slices until warm.
